自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(15)
  • 收藏
  • 关注

转载 vuex退出登录数据重置

const state = {}var copyState = deepClone(state) // 拷贝state对象function deepClone (obj) { var newObj = obj instanceof Array ? [] : {} for (var i in obj) { newObj[i] = typeof obj[i] === 'object...

2019-05-07 11:18:00 1097

转载 JavaScript instanceof 运算符深入剖析

instanceof 运算符简介 在 JavaScript 中,判断一个变量的类型尝尝会用 typeof 运算符,在使用 typeof 运算符时采用引用类型存储值会出现一个问题,无论引用的是什么类型的对象,它都返回 "object"。ECMAScript 引入了另一个 Java 运算符 instanceof 来解决这个问题。instanceof 运算符与 typeof 运算符相似,用于...

2019-05-07 11:15:00 125

转载 vue如何监听浏览器刷新事件呢?不仅仅是页面销毁就触发的事件。

在created、mounted 都行啊。 window.addEventListener('beforeunload',e => { localStorage.setItem("store",JSON.stringify(this.$store.state)) }); 转载于:https://www.cnblogs.com/lijjj/p/10821...

2019-05-06 19:43:00 1916

转载 解决vue页面刷新后原先获取的vuex中state消失的问题

在 app.vue中的created函数中写如下代码:localstorage和sessionStorage都可以 //在页面加载时读取sessionStorage里的状态信息 if (sessionStorage.getItem("store") ) { this.$store.replaceState(Object.assign({}, this.$store.state,JS...

2019-05-06 19:39:00 295

转载 Uncaught Error: OBJLoader: Unexpected line: "<!DOCTYPE html>"

问题: vue-3d-model.esm.js?e678:44779 Uncaught Error: OBJLoader: Unexpected line: "<!DOCTYPE html>" at OBJLoader.parse (vue-3d-model.esm.js?e678:44779) at Object.eval [as onLoad] (vue-3...

2019-04-16 14:58:00 2824

转载 v-on 事件修饰符

v-on 事件修饰符常用的事件修饰符有: .stop 阻止事件冒泡 .self 当事件在该元素本身触发时才触发事件 .capture 添加事件侦听器是,使用事件捕获模式 .prevent 阻止默认事件 .once 事件只触发一次 什么是事件冒泡<!DOCTYPE html><html lang="en"><head> <met...

2019-02-28 16:26:00 89

转载 v-model 修饰符

v-model 的修饰符,一般用于控制数据同步的时机1、.trim 自动过滤输入内容最开始 和 最后的 空格,中间的会保留一个空格,多的会被过滤掉 <div id="v1"> <input type="text" v-model.trim="val"> <p> {{ val }}</p> </div> ...

2019-02-28 15:59:00 83

转载 http statusCode(状态码) 200、300、400、500序列

201-206都表示服务器成功处理了请求的状态代码,说明网页可以正常访问。200(成功) 服务器已成功处理了请求。通常,这表示服务器提供了请求的网页。201(已创建) 请求成功且服务器已创建了新的资源。202(已接受) 服务器已接受了请求,但尚未对其进行处理。203(非授权信息) 服务器已成功处理了请求,但返回了...

2019-02-18 13:45:00 117

转载 JS 时间转换函数 字符串时间转换毫秒(互转)

字符串转化为日期 let util = function(){ Date.prototype.Format = function(fmt) { var o = { "M+" : this.getMonth()+1, //月份 "d+" : this.getDate(), ...

2018-11-30 13:17:00 650

转载 Bootstrap之表格checkbox复选框全选

HTMl中无需添加额外的一列来表示复选框,而是由JS完成,所以正常的表格布局就行了: <table class="table table-bordered table-hover"> <thead> <tr class="success"> <th>类别编号</th> <th>类别名称</th...

2018-11-13 14:23:00 98

转载 JavaScript数组去重(12种方法,史上最全)

JavaScript4天前 数组去重,一般都是在面试的时候才会碰到,一般是要求手写数组去重方法的代码。如果是被提问到,数组去重的方法有哪些?你能答出其中的10种,面试官很有可能对你刮目相看。在真实的项目中碰到的数组去重,一般都是后台去处理,很少让前端处理数组去重。虽然日常项目用到的概率比较低,但还是需要了解一下,以防面试的时候可能回被问到。 注:写的匆忙,加上这几天有点忙...

2018-09-27 15:09:00 118

转载 JavaScript常用数组操作方法,包含ES6方法

一、concat() concat() 方法用于连接两个或多个数组。该方法不会改变现有的数组,仅会返回被连接数组的一个副本。 var arr1 = [1,2,3]; var arr2 = [4,5]; var arr3 = arr1.concat(arr2); console.log(arr1); //[1, 2, 3] console...

2018-09-25 15:09:00 169

转载 vue-carousel

title API https://github.com/SSENSE/vue-carousel/blob/master/docs/source/api/index.md Global config autoplay Flag to enable autoplay Type:Boolean Default:fals...

2018-09-20 13:53:00 590

转载 v-if vs v-show

v-if是“真正”的条件渲染,因为它会确保在切换过程中条件块内的事件监听器和子组件适当地被销毁和重建。 v-if也是惰性的:如果在初始渲染时条件为假,则什么也不做——直到条件第一次变为真时,才会开始渲染条件块。 相比之下,v-show就简单得多——不管初始条件是什么,元素总是会被渲染,并且只是简单地基于 CSS 进行切换。 一般来说,v-if有更高的切换开销,而v-...

2018-09-14 15:10:00 89

转载 v-bind:的基本用法

1. v-bind:class(根据需求进行选择) 1.1 <style> .box{ background-color: #ff0; } .textColor{ color: #000; } .textSize{ font-size: 30px; } </style> <div id="app">...

2018-09-14 09:40:00 200

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除